Deconstructing the RICE Protocol
The foundation of this method lies in its four distinct letters, each representing a critical physiological action. Understanding the science behind R—I—C—E— moves beyond simple memorization, revealing a strategy designed to work with the body’s natural healing processes. This sequence is not arbitrary; it is a logical progression intended to mitigate the immediate damage caused by trauma and prevent secondary complications.
Rest: The Foundation of Recovery
The first component, Rest, emphasizes the immediate cessation of activity. Continuing to use an injured ligament or muscle exacerbates the damage and increases bleeding into the surrounding tissues. By stopping all movement, you halt the progression of the injury and initiate the body’s stabilization response, creating a secure environment for the healing cascade to begin.
Ice: The Anti-inflammatory Agent
Next, Ice addresses the body’s inflammatory reaction. When tissue is damaged, blood flow increases to the area, causing swelling and pain. Applying a cold source constricts blood vessels, dramatically reducing this inflammation and numbing the nerve endings to alleviate acute pain. This step is vital for controlling the secondary damage that occurs after the initial impact.
Compression: Managing the Swelling
Compression involves wrapping the affected area with an elastic bandage to apply gentle, consistent pressure. This mechanical force prevents fluids from pooling in the interstitial spaces, thereby controlling the buildup of swelling. Proper compression restricts the area enough to limit bruising and provide a sense of structural support, but it must be monitored to ensure it does not impede circulation.
Elevation: Defeating Gravity
Finally, Elevation utilizes gravity to assist the venous and lymphatic return system. By raising the injured limb above the level of the heart, you encourage fluid to drain away from the injury site. This reduces the tension in the tissues, minimizes further bleeding, and significantly accelerates the resolution of swelling and discomfort.
Beyond the Basics: The Evolution to PEACE
Medical understanding evolves, and the rigid interpretation of RICE has recently been expanded to reflect new insights into soft tissue healing. The updated PEACE protocol retains the principles of Protection, Elevation, Avoidance of Anti-inflammatories, Compression, and Education, but it shifts the focus away from strictly inhibiting inflammation, recognizing that it is a necessary part of the initial healing phase.
When Rice is Not Enough
While the rice first aid acronym is a vital tool for acute injuries, it is not a universal solution. Severe fractures, deep wounds with uncontrolled bleeding, or injuries involving numbness and discoloration require immediate professional medical intervention. The protocol is designed for mild to moderate sprains and strains; recognizing the boundary between self-care and emergency care is a critical component of first aid proficiency.
